What is Tool Explorer?
Tool Explorer indexes the callable tool names and descriptions attached to public registry profiles. It is useful for seeing what agents can actually invoke, not just which profile exists.
How do category and verb filters work?
Category filters use the live registry category rollup. Verb filters use the public tool insights rollup, so the page stays backed by the same read models as the tracker charts.
Why do auth requirements matter?
Auth requirements show whether a tool is likely usable without account connection, requires authentication, is private, or is unknown in the current snapshot.
